Taxonomic Classification

Rank bilby Pale fox
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class same Mammalia (Mammals)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Peramelemorphia (Peramelemorphia) Carnivora (Carnivorans)
Family Thylacomyidae Canidae (Dogs & Wolves)
Genus Macrotis Vulpes (Foxes)
Species Macrotis lagotis Vulpes pallida

Evolutionary Relationship

bilby and Pale fox share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(Mammals)
